The series profiles self-made South Africans with noteworthy achievements, which demonstrates the importance of internal-agency in the process of self-development. The achievers use their life stories to unpack the process of character development, self-belief, the importance of values, and personal philosophies in building a successful life determined by one’s desires and dreams. The series will feature guests across the racial lines and from different disciplines. The show will feature people like Dr. Imtiaz Sooliman, Pastor Musa Sono, and Mirriam Zwane - just to name a few.

Allie-Paine is a media professional with a wealth of experience across various platforms including online media, print, radio and television. She is also a radio announcer and news reporter/presenter. Armed with a Bachelor of Arts Degree in Communication Science and over eight years in the media industry, Allie-Paine is currently the producer and presenter of SABC2’s breakfast show, Morning Live.
